Legend of the Galactic Heroes: Vermilion's Mortal Battle
By Nishiki Taitei
This is a doujin game that was produced for sale at Game Shows in Japan (such as Tokyo Game Marker). To get one you needed to preorder it in advance and then pick it up at the show. This game is set in the Legend of the Galactic Heroes Universe, an anime series that is very popular in Japan. The game deals with the Battle of Vermilion, which occurred during the Empire's invasion of Alliance territory. The game's system is based on Command Magazine issue 53's game called Grunwald 1410. Game Scale: 1 hex is about 28 light seconds (about 8.3 billion km) 1 turn is about half a day 1 unit is about 500 ships The game is a doujin and requires assembly. —user summary
